日期:2014-05-19  浏览次数:20450 次

用过ajax.dll的进来下
当用多表联接的select返回dataset时,如果二个表有同名字段,在javascript怎么输出这个字段
比如:select   *   from   日记表   left   join   日记分类   on   日记表.分类id=日记分类.分类id

这时response.value.Tables[0].Rows[i].分类id就取不出来了。

------解决方案--------------------
去SQL SERVER里执行一下你的查询语句,看结果里的两个字段分别是什么名字
------解决方案--------------------
在SQL里面将他们命名为不同的名字就可以了,一个as Aid,一个as Bid

另外,ajax.dll调用的后台方法中不能使用response方法